WWE Champion Big E. was a guest on the The Ariel Helwani Show as he figured he would be holding the Money in the Bank briefcase longer than he had originally expected. Big E. said,
“I thought it was going to be long and drawn out. At one point, it looked like I was going to be doing stuff with Corbin. Then there was the stuff with Logan Paul, so you think maybe that’s the direction things are going for a while. As you know, it’s a topsy turvy company of ours and things change all the time, so you never know. You also have Otis, who had the briefcase and didn’t end up becoming World Champion. That’s happened in other instances. You never know if that’s going to be you too. I’m glad that was not the case for me.”
Big E. cashed in his briefcase on the September 13th edition of WWE Monday Night RAW, defeating then champion Bobby Lashley to capture his first major WWE Championship.
